Teratogen
Environmental agent, such as a virus, a drug, or radiation, that can interfere with normal prenatal development and cause developmental abnormalities.
Birth Defect
An abnormality in structure, function, or metabolism present at birth that results in physical or mental disability or is fatal.
Cesarean Delivery
A surgical procedure used to deliver a baby through incisions in the mother's abdomen and uterus.
HIV
A virus known as Human Immunodeficiency Virus targets the immune system and, without treatment, can cause Acquired Immunodeficiency Syndrome (AIDS).
